Does sleep affect water retention and bloating?
Sleep is a master regulator of your body's fluid balance β and poor sleep reliably triggers water retention and bloating. During deep sleep, your kidneys shift into conservation mode guided by antidiuretic hormone (ADH), while the glymphatic system flushes excess fluid from tissues. When sleep is disrupted, ADH secretion becomes dysregulated, cortisol rises (causing sodium retention), and the lymphatic drainage that normally reduces morning puffiness is impaired. Studies show that even one night of restricted sleep can increase next-day body weight by 1-3 pounds purely from fluid shifts. How Sleep Regulates Fluid Balance
### Antidiuretic Hormone (ADH/Vasopressin)
ADH is the primary hormone controlling how much water your kidneys retain or release. Its secretion follows a precise circadian rhythm:
- βNormal pattern: ADH rises during sleep, peaking in the early morning hours (2-4 AM)
- βPurpose: prevents excessive urine production during sleep so you don't wake to urinate
- βMorning drop: ADH decreases upon waking, allowing normal urine production to resume
- βDisrupted sleep effect: ADH rhythm becomes erratic β either over-secreting (causing daytime retention) or under-secreting (causing nighttime bathroom trips)
When sleep is chronically disrupted, the ADH rhythm loses its sharp peak-and-trough pattern, leading to fluid retention during waking hours and frequent urination during sleep β the worst of both worlds.
### Cortisol and Sodium Retention
Sleep deprivation elevates cortisol, which directly causes the kidneys to retain sodium. Where sodium goes, water follows:
- βElevated cortisol increases aldosterone sensitivity β the mineralocorticoid that drives sodium retention
- βEach gram of retained sodium holds approximately 200ml of water
- βSleep-deprived individuals retain 500-1000mg more sodium daily even with identical diets
- βResult: 1-3 pounds of additional water weight from sodium-driven retention
### The Lymphatic and Glymphatic Systems
Your body has two critical drainage systems that are most active during sleep:
- βLymphatic system β drains excess interstitial fluid from tissues back into the bloodstream
- βGlymphatic system β brain-specific drainage that is 60% more active during deep sleep
- βFacial puffiness β lymphatic drainage from the face and around the eyes depends on sleep quality and horizontal position
- βPeripheral edema β fluid pooling in extremities (feet, ankles, hands) worsens with disrupted lymphatic cycling
During deep sleep, the interstitial spaces between cells expand by up to 60%, allowing cerebrospinal fluid to flush waste and excess fluid. This is why a good night's sleep literally makes your face look less puffy.
The Bloating Connection
### Gut Motility and Gas
Bloating isn't just about fluid β it's also about gas and motility, both of which sleep regulates:
- βGut motility slows with poor sleep β gas moves through the intestines more slowly, accumulating and causing distension
- βMicrobiome shifts β sleep disruption alters bacterial populations toward gas-producing species within 48 hours
- βSwallowed air increases β mouth-breathing during fragmented sleep and stress-related air swallowing (aerophagia) increase overnight gas accumulation
- βVisceral sensitivity rises β the same amount of gas FEELS more uncomfortable when sleep-deprived
### Inflammatory Fluid Retention
Poor sleep triggers systemic low-grade inflammation, which causes fluid shifts into tissues:
- βC-reactive protein rises after just two nights of restricted sleep
- βHistamine levels increase β causing vasodilation and fluid leakage into tissues
- βProstaglandin E2 increases β promotes fluid retention in joints and soft tissues
- βGut barrier permeability rises β allowing partial immune activation that drives whole-body fluid retention

Practical Strategies to Reduce Sleep-Related Water Retention
### Sleep Optimization
- β7-8 hours minimum β ADH rhythm requires consistent, adequate sleep to function properly
- βConsistent sleep-wake timing β the fluid regulation hormones are circadian; irregular schedules disrupt them
- βElevate the head slightly β a 10-15 degree incline promotes facial lymphatic drainage
- βCool bedroom β heat causes vasodilation and peripheral fluid accumulation
### Daily Habits
- βFront-load hydration β 60-70% of water intake before 3 PM
- βReduce evening sodium β below 500mg in the last meal
- βMorning movement β even a 10-minute walk activates lymphatic drainage
- βPotassium-rich foods β bananas, avocados, spinach help counterbalance sodium retention
- βLimit alcohol β suppresses ADH acutely, then causes rebound over-secretion (the classic hangover puffiness)
### When Fluid Retention Signals Something More
Occasional water retention from poor sleep is normal. However, persistent edema, sudden weight gain of 5+ pounds, or swelling in only one limb should be evaluated by a physician to rule out cardiac, renal, or vascular causes.
